Chocolate Chip Pistachio Cookies How can I make the chocolate chip pistachio cookies dairy-free or vegan? Replace the butter with an oat or cashew-based spread suitable for baking. Use plant-based chocolate for drizzling and ensure the pistachio paste contains no dairy additives. Substitute the large egg with a flax or chia egg by mixing one tablespoon of ground flaxseed or chia seeds with three tablespoons of water and letting it sit until gel-like. Dairy Free Vanilla Biscoff Roll Cake How do I prevent my Biscoff roll cake from cracking when rolling? It is important to roll the sponge while it is still warm and pliable, immediately after baking. Once inverted onto parchment paper, roll it up gently with the paper inside and allow it to cool in that shape. This technique helps the cake “remember” its rolled structure, making it easier to fill and reroll later without breaking. Gluten Free Chocolate Brownie Cookies How do I store the gluten free chocolate brownie cookies? Let them cool completely on a wire rack before transferring them to an airtight container. At room temperature, they will stay fresh for about 3 days, keeping their chewy centers and crackly tops. For longer storage, place them in the refrigerator for up to a week, though they may firm up slightly. Kinder Cheesecake Cups with Bueno Topping How can I make this Kinder cheesecake dairy-free or vegan? Replace the cream cheese with a plant-based alternative such as cashew cream, almond-based cream cheese, or soy cream cheese. Use coconut cream, oat cream, or cashew cream instead of heavy cream for whipping. Substitute the Kinder chocolate and Kinder Bueno bars with vegan chocolate bars and vegan hazelnut cream-filled chocolate bars. Ensure all sugar and chocolate ingredients are vegan-certified. Nutella Challah How can I make this Nutella challah in advance? You can make the dough a day ahead and let it rise slowly in the refrigerator overnight, which also develops flavor. The next day, shape, fill, and braid the dough before letting it rise again at room temperature. Another option is to fully bake the challah, cool it completely, and freeze it wrapped tightly in plastic wrap and foil. When ready to serve, reheat in a 300°F oven until warmed through. No Bake Peanut Butter Chocolate Bars How to slice these no bake peanut butter chocolate bars It’s important that they are fully set in the freezer for at least two hours. Remove the pan from the freezer and use a sharp knife, preferably warmed under hot water and wiped dry before cutting. Cut slowly with gentle pressure, cleaning the knife between slices if needed. This prevents the layers from smearing or sticking. Salted Caramel Donuts with Pastry Cream Can I bake the donuts instead of frying them? Traditional salted caramel donuts are fried because the hot oil creates a tender interior and golden exterior that baking cannot fully replicate. While baked versions exist, the texture is closer to brioche or sweet rolls than to classic donuts. If you prefer baking, you can shape the dough, place it in a muffin pan or baking sheet, and bake at 350°F/175°C until golden brown, then fill and glaze as directed. No Bake Chocolate Coconut Roll How can I make this chocolate coconut roll dairy-free or vegan? Replace the milk chocolate with a high-quality dairy-free dark chocolate or vegan milk chocolate. Substitute the heavy cream with coconut cream, which gives richness and blends well with the coconut filling. Use vegan butter or a cashew-based butter alternative for both the chocolate layer and the filling. Make sure your biscuits are dairy-free, as some tea biscuits contain butter or milk powder. Gluten Free Strawberry Dessert Crumble How can I make this gluten free strawberry dessert ahead of time? The dessert can be prepared a day in advance by cooking the strawberry filling, assembling the crumble topping, and keeping them separate until baking. Store the cooked filling in an airtight container in the refrigerator and refrigerate the crumble mixture as well. When ready to bake, assemble the two in a dish and bake as directed.
